The Trojan War: Achilles Tent. ca. 1470. Scenes from the interview between Hector and Achilles and the battle between Greeks and Trojans. Sixth cloth of the series, work of the Master of Coetivy, Henry or Conrard of Vulcop (active 1454-1479). Manufacturing of Tournai. Wool and silk. 6/7 threads. Flemish art. Tapestry. SPAIN. Zamora. Cathedral Museum
